Transaction e77f11689766cb5d43ff5fbcda4d88fbf96a12281cb680fa029a5cb25abc39d7

1 Input
2 Outputs
  • e77f11689766cb5d43ff5fbcda4d88fbf96a12281cb680fa029a5cb25abc39d7:0
  • value  117077608
    address  32TZM6PHrAQ7SrR4JVDLMpYHC55UXr44Au
  • e77f11689766cb5d43ff5fbcda4d88fbf96a12281cb680fa029a5cb25abc39d7:1
  • value  2700000
    address  39DhRJ7QERkuMgZXE2rfCWCPB5KK2Vr7X2